 Family History Sources Other Occupations
List of European inhabitants sometimes appear in Factory Records [IOR: G], and Proceedings [IOR: P] Applications for permission to travel to India up to 1833 are recorded in Court Minutes [IOR:B] and in the records of the Committee of Correspondence [IOR: D].
List of Europeans and others in the English factories in Bengal at the time of the siege of Calcutta in the year 1756.
Lists of Europeans in Calcutta and the country districts, showing year of arrival and ship in which arrived, Bengal calendar 1790.

 CNN.com - Europe's wealthy move up rich list - March 1, 2002
The other Europeans in the billionaires' Top 20 are Sweden's Ingvar Kamprad of furniture giant IKEA (16th, $13.4 billion) and UK-based Swedes Kirsten Rausing and family (19th, $10.7 million) whose father invented "Tetra" packaging.
Other prominent Europeans include Spanish fashio guru Amancio Ortega, founder of Zara (25th, $9.1 billion), biotech dynasty Ernesto Bertarelli and family of Switzerland (31st, $8.4 billion), and the Netherlands' Charlene de Carvalho (76th, $4.3 billion) who inherited control of the Heineken empire from her father when he died in January.
The list was set using stock prices and exchange rates as of February 4.
